9 L丶l楽

尚未进行身份认证

暂无相关描述

等级
博文 7
排名 181w+

指定Springboot项目的jar运行内存以及GC相关内容

运行一个jar的基本命令(一般用来在线测试项目启动情况)命令:java-jarxxx.jar有时项目暂用内存比较大,这时候需要指定项目运行内容(像Eureak暂用不需要那么多,但是默认启动会暂用15%左右的内存,对于4G的系统)指定命令:例子1:java-Xms10m-Xmx200m-jarxxx.jar#指定初始化分配堆内存10M,最大堆内存200M的空间分...

2019-05-30 11:36:51

JVM(一)Java内存模型

转自:https://www.cnblogs.com/warehouse/p/9466137.html前言对于从事C、C++程序开发的开发人员来说,在开始使用对象之前,他们都需要使用new关键字为对象申请内存空间,在使用完对象之后,也需要使用delete关键字来释放对象占用的内存空间。对于Java程序员来说,在虚拟机自动内存管理机制的帮助下,不再需要为每一个new操作是写匹配的del...

2019-05-24 00:01:30

JavaGC原理

参考资料:http://blog.csdn.net/flamezyg/article/details/44673951http://www.blogjava.net/ldwblog/archive/2013/07/24/401919.htmlhttp://www.360doc.com/content/12/1023/16/9615799_243296263.shtmlhttps:/...

2019-05-23 23:58:09

java学习路线

2019-05-23 14:57:10

JAVA堆栈图解

转自:http://www.iteye.com/topic/6345301.寄存器:最快的存储区,由编译器根据需求进行分配,我们在程序中无法控制.2.栈:存放基本类型的变量数据和对象的引用,但对象本身不存放在栈中,而是存放在堆(new出来的对象)或者常量池中(对象可能在常量池里)(字符串常量对象存放在常量池中。)3.堆:存放所有new出来的对象。4.静态域:存放静态成员(stat...

2019-05-23 14:45:04

java堆、栈、堆栈的区别

转自https://www.cnblogs.com/iliuyuet/p/5603618.html1.栈(stack)与堆(heap)都是Java用来在Ram中存放数据的地方。与C++不同,Java自动管理栈和堆,程序员不能直接地设置栈或堆。  2.栈的优势是,存取速度比堆要快,仅次于直接位于CPU中的寄存器。但缺点是,存在栈中的数据大小与生存期必须是确定的,缺乏灵活性。另外,栈数据...

2019-05-23 14:42:48

IT行业各种术语

IT行业各种术语科普一下IT行业各种术语:冷备份假设你是一位女性,你有一位男朋友,于此同时你和另外一位男生暧昧不清,比朋友好,又不是恋人。你随时可以甩了现任男友,另外一位马上就能补上。这是冷备份。双机热备份假设你是一位女性,同时和两位男性在交往,两位都是你男朋友。并且他们还互不干涉,独立运行。这就是双机热备份。异地容灾备份假设你是一位女性,不安于男朋友给你的安全感。在遥远...

2017-12-13 17:19:50
奖章
    暂无奖章